      @@gautambhattacharjee334 Just keep practicing. Use less water and be quick. LOL I had the same problem, still do sometimes. I think that we've all have that problem in the beginning. Acrylics dry fast; so that does cause a bit of a dilemma. You seem to recognize your problem so just start over. You can always gesso over a painting if you're not happy with it and reuse that canvas. But it is good to keep some of your first paintings so that you can compare in a year to see your progress. I've gathered up different techniques from several painters; especially Chuck; he's my all time favorite. Not just saying that, either. You can even try some of the One Stroke paintings just for the sake of brush techniques then come back to landscapes and you'll see several areas of the painting that you can apply some of your One Stroke painting techniques with landscapes.

      Actually it's really not a good idea to paint oil or acrylic over each other. That's just the one thing I have to say. Otherwise his pants are just mind-boggling the amazing and beautiful. But yeah you don't mix oil and acrylic in the same painting. We can get cracks or things flaking off overtime because they don't adhere to each other etcetera Etc
